This paper describes a mathematical model developed to study the behaviour of LPG tanks when subjected to fire conditions. The model consists of a number of field and zone sub-models which are used to simulate the various physical phenomena taking place during the tank experimental data obtained by the Health and Safety Executive, U.K.. The comparisons indicate that the model can accurately predict the tank pressure and time to first valve opening. The model is used to investigate the effect of the tank diameter on the thermal stratification in the liquid region.
